Dressing of net-caught cuttlefish with spring onion

Tender cuttlefish caught using traditional trasmallo nets is finely chopped and dressed with a light, citrus-infused seasoning. The dish is garnished with slices of fresh scallions, adding a subtle onion-like sharpness. Served cold, it's a refreshing seafood starter that highlights the delicate flavor of the cuttlefish.
